Dr Rocco Loiacono
Dr Rocco Loiacono is a senior lecturer at Curtin University Law School in Perth, Australia, specialising in property law and legal research. He holds a PhD from the University of Western Australia and has extensive experience in commercial property law, having worked at Clayton Utz. Dr. Loiacono is an active commentator, contributing to publications like Sky News Australia, The Spectator Australia, and The Catholic Weekly. He is also a NAATI-certified Italian-English translator and served as the national president of the Australian Institute of Interpreters and Translators (AUSIT) from 2017 to 2019.
